After weeks of frustration trying my FSX to work properly I just can't get it done perhaps due to the fact the FSX:Acceleration is too demanding. I have two PCs both with the FSX and both keep freezing up on me. Perhaps I need to upgrade my rig. Both FSX in both my PC were working just fine and all of a sudden after a period of time I have not played the game now they're freezing up on me despite low settings. I considering seriously about uninstalling my FSX: Acceleration and go with two possible flight sim games. One is the FSX:Steam and the other Proflight which as I understand are not as demanding as the FSX:Acceleration. Is this a wise or a dumb move?

I hate to tell you but ProFlight is a scam :evil:,don't waste your money. It is actually a free sim called FlightGear. So good news is you can use FlightGear for free :D . Simviation post about ProFlight viewtopic.php?f=50&t=174070. Link for FlightGear http://www.flightgear.org/
